About the Department

The Peer Support Specialist is a valuable member of our Williams Consent Decree team who provides support to clients based on their own experiences. 

  • Responsible for engaging and motivating the identified population to seek needed services. 
  • Explains, guides, supports, and assists clients with goals of improved stability and self-sufficiency, independent living, self-advocacy, and development of supportive relationships. 
  • Responsible for assisting individuals with serious mental illness to increase skills in the areas of independent living and self-advocacy. Co-leads client activities.

Position Duties


  • Assists in the planning and implementation of activities of the Drop-In Center
  • Assists in the development and leading of mental health recovery groups.
  • Assists in the development and leading of advocacy training groups.
  • Provides supportive peer counseling.
  • Assists in implementing independent living skills and leading independent living skills classes and groups.
  • Assist with transportation of client(s) to and from home and outings
  • Assists in providing community consultation and education, as assigned.
  • Assists in the development and facilitation of training to clients and the community.
  • Explains LCHD programs to clients and/or family
  • Assists family through the intake, referral, and connection with other agencies.
  • Provides support and advocacy for families receiving services.

Minimum Qualifications

  • High school diploma or G.E.D. certificate required; 
  • Certified Recovery Support Specialist (CRSS) strongly preferred.
  • Requires one year of direct and personal experience with the mental health system as a primary consumer of services. Demonstrated ability to utilize lived experience to provide peer support, advocacy, and encouragement to clients.
  • Must possess a valid driver’s license and have an acceptable driving record.
  • Requires use of personal vehicle when an LCHD fleet vehicle is not available for outreach activities or to respond to crisis calls in the field.
